quickselect:JavaScript中的快速选择算法 源码
快速选择 JavaScript中一个微小且快速的(特别是)。 quickselect ( array , k [ , left , right , compareFn ] ) ; 重新排列项目,使[left, k]中的所有项目最小。 在[left, right]第k个元素的最小值为(k - left + 1) 。 array :要部分排序的数组(就地) k :用于部分排序的中间索引(如上定义) left :要排序范围的左索引(默认为0 ) right :右索引(默认情况下数组的最后一个索引) compareFn :比较功能 例: var arr = [ 65 , 28 , 5
文件列表
quickselect-master.zip
(预估有个10文件)
quickselect-master
.travis.yml
48B
rollup.config.js
169B
index.js
1KB
test.js
292B
package.json
996B
LICENSE
750B
index.d.ts
602B
bench.js
286B
.gitignore
21B
暂无评论